A GERMAN PARCEL-GILT SILVER BEAKER
MARK OF MATTHAUS SCHMIDT, AUGSBURG, 1680-1685
Tapering cylindrical, chased with large scrolling flowers and foliage, marked on base
4 in. (10 cm.) high
4 oz. 1 dwt. (127 gr.)
